Three-Dimensional Transesophageal Echocardiography of Pacemaker Endocarditis
JACC - Journal of the American College of Cardiology, 04/20/09
Jain R et al. - A 62-year-old man developed pleuritic chest pain, fever, chills, and diaphoresis 3 days after radiofrequency ablation for atrial flutter. He had a history of nonischemic cardiomyopathy and had a biventricular pacemaker-implantable cardiac defibrillator placed 7 months earlier. Within 24 h of the first fever, multiple sets of blood cultures were positive for Staphylococcal aureus. A transthoracic echocardiogram did not demonstrate any vegetations on the valves or pacemaker leads. A transesophageal echocardiogram (TEE) with real-time 3-dimensional imaging using a matrix array transducer was performed.
